Railways:
total: 1,580 km
country comparison to the world: 79
standard gauge: 345 km 1.435-m gauge (345 km electrified)
narrow gauge: 1,085 km 1.067-m gauge (685 km electrified); 150 km 0.762-m gauge
note: the 0.762 gauge track belongs to three entities, the Forestry Bureau, Taiwan Cement, and TaiPower (2010)

Roadways:
total: 41,475 km
country comparison to the world: 88
paved: 41,033 km (includes 720 km of expressways)
unpaved: 442 km (2009)

Merchant marine:
total: 101
country comparison to the world: 50
by type: bulk carrier 28, cargo 19, chemical tanker 2, container 27, passenger/cargo 4, petroleum tanker 12, refrigerated cargo 7, roll on/roll off 2
foreign-owned: 2 (France 1, Vietnam 1)
registered in other countries: 574 (Cambodia 1, Honduras 2, Hong Kong 26, Indonesia 1, Italy 11, Kiribati 5, Liberia 88, Marshall Islands 2, Panama 337, Philippines 1, Sierra Leone 1, Singapore 79, Thailand 1, UK 11, unknown 8) (2010)
